Seven Luxurious Cars To Look Out For In 2022

Luke Pereira
27/01/2022

Looking for luxury? Well, settle into your Eames lounge chair and read more about these seven high-end luxury cars headed for Singapore this year.


SINGAPORE

2021 saw the launch of a whole bunch of high-end luxury cars in Singapore, including the likes of the Mercedes-Benz S-Class, BMW iX and Audi E-Tron GT, to name a few.

There’s more to come this year, and if you’d like to feel ten feet tall and can afford the very best life has to offer, well, lucky you. Here are the cars heading your way that will have you feeling like a million bucks.



Audi

R8 V10 Performance RWD 

Audi’s 5.2-litre V10 engine – as seen in the Huracan – is arguably still one of the best high-performance engines out there. The R8 V10 Performance RWD comes with a V10 engine that produces 560 horsepower and 550 Nm of torque, allowing the car to go from 0-100km in just 3.7 seconds. Dynamic steering is now available for the first time for the rear-wheel-drive R8 which makes the car more nimble and fun to drive. It is slated to reach our shores in the first half of the year costing at least S$750,000 without COE.

BMW

M850i xDrive Coupe 

BMW’s updated 8 Series is the first of several new cars that BMW will be introducing this year. The updated 8 Series lineup, includes the Coupe, Convertible and four-door Gran Coupe. BMW has announced a mild mid-life facelift for its 8 Series luxury coupe, with minor cosmetic changes and extra equipment added across the range.

The M850i xDrive gets a 4.4-litre twin-turbo V8 engine producing 530 horsepower and 750 Nm of torque. The current M850i xDrive Coupe costs S$577,888 without COE, and the facelifted model is expected to cost around the same when it arrives in Singapore in the second quarter of 2022.

Ferrari

296 GTB

Fun fact: those three numbers on the 296 GTB stand for, 2.9-litre, V6 engine. The 296 GTB packs 818 horsepower and 546 Nm of torque. That would zip you from 0-100km in just 2.9 seconds. In addition, 0-200km takes only 7.3 seconds.

In electric mode, the 296 GTB possesses a range of 25km with a top speed of 180km/h. The Ferrari 296 GTB is expected to arrive in February 2022 with a price of around S$1,200,000 without COE.

Maserati

MC20

The MC20 is an all-new model for the Maserati lineup, and the ‘MC’ in its name refers to Maserati Corse – a signal that the brand will perhaps soon re-enter racing events with a track-only variant of the car.

The MC20 is offered as a two-seater coupe, with a convertible expected to join the lineup later and eventually an electric MC20 will reach production too. The 3.0-litre V6 twin-turbocharged engine pumps out 630 horsepower. Called Nettuno, the new engine utilizes a unique twin-combustion system borrowed from Formula 1 race cars. 0-100km/h would only take you 2.9 seconds, on your way to a high top speed of 325km/h.

You can expect the MC20 to be available in March this year with a price of around S$748,000 without COE.

McLaren

Artura

The Artura is an all-new model that features a hybrid V6 powertrain and introduces a new platform called MCLA for the British supercar maker. It’s the first plug-in hybrid series production car ever made by McLaren.

The Artura is powered by a 3.0-litre twin-turbocharged V6 engine that produces 680 horsepower and 720 Nm of torque. It takes only 3 seconds to go from 0-100km with a top speed of 330km/h. In electric mode, McLaren says you get a range of up to 30km with a top speed of up to 130km/h.

The McLaren Artura is scheduled to arrive around mid-year, with a starting retail price of just under a million without COE.

Mercedes-Benz

Mercedes-Maybach S-Class

It takes a lot to outclass a Mercedes-Benz S-Class, but the 2022 Mercedes-Maybach S-Class does just that. This sedan is a worthy rival to the Bentley Flying Spur or Rolls-Royce Ghost given its number of high-end features.

The S 580 4Matic is powered by a 4.0-litre, twin-turbo V8 petrol engine which is tuned to produce 496 horsepower and 700 Nm of torque. 0-100km/h would take you just 4.4 seconds.

The Mercedes-Maybach GLS 600 and S 580 have been priced in Singapore and are available for ordering – read our full news story for all the details.

Pagani

Huayra R

The new Pagani Huayra R will feature a 6.0-litre V-12 engine tuned to produce 850 horsepower and 750 Nm of torque. That’s 130 more horsepower than the ‘regular’ Huayra.

Newly-appointed Pagani distributor Eurokars Supersports (EKSS) has not revealed how many units are reserved for Singapore as there are only 30 units manufactured worldwide. The track-only car will be available in the fourth quarter of 2022, priced at approximately five million Singapore dollars without COE.
